Bristle Type Matters

When selecting a brush for your long-haired cat, the type of bristles plays a critical role in both coat health and comfort. Bristles with rounded tips-like rubber-coated or soft plastic caps-prevent skin irritation while detangling dense undercoats. Stainless steel bristles, fine and closely spaced, penetrate thick fur to remove loose undercoat hair without damaging the topcoat. Angled or bent bristles, set at 120° to 150°, improve reach into the undercoat for efficient deshedding. Soft, protective tips are essential for sensitive pets, reducing pulling and discomfort. Bristle density and flexibility must balance deep coat penetration with gentleness to avoid matting or skin abrasion. A well-designed bristle layout guarantees thorough grooming without snagging delicate fur. You need a brush that combines precision engineering with feline safety. Choose bristles that are both effective and kind to your cat’s skin and coat.

Coat Penetration Ability

Reaching deep into thick fur, a well-designed brush separates tangles and removes loose undercoat hair before mats form. You need a tool that penetrates the topcoat to reach the dense underlayer where shedding and matting start. Bristles angled at 150° slice through thick fur without skimming the surface. Thicker pins-1.2 times wider than standard-offer added strength to push through resistance and lift trapped hair. Tightly spaced, long bristles grab dead undercoat efficiently, unlike widely spaced designs that let debris slip through. Rounded, smooth tips help the brush glide without snagging or catching delicate strands. This precise engineering guarantees consistent contact from skin to surface. Without deep reach, dead hair stays trapped, leading to knots and discomfort. A brush with strong coat penetration clears the undercoat effectively. It’s not just about surface grooming-it’s about targeting the root of tangles where they begin.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Often Should I Brush My Long Haired Cat?

You should brush your long-haired cat daily. Regular brushing prevents matting and reduces shedding. Without daily grooming, tangles form quickly in dense undercoats. Use a steel comb with fine and wide teeth to detect knots early. Follow with a slicker brush to lift loose fur. This routine maintains coat health, minimizes hairballs, and strengthens your bond. Skip days, and debris traps close to skin, causing irritation. Consistency guarantees best results.

Can I Use Human Brushes on My Long Haired Cat?

No, you shouldn’t use human brushes on your long-haired cat. Human brushes lack the proper bristle spacing and flexibility for pet fur. Cat-specific brushes have wider tooth gaps to prevent pulling. They’re designed to reach the undercoat without irritating the skin. Human brushes can damage your cat’s coat and cause discomfort. Always use tools made for feline grooming needs.

Are Slicker Brushes Safe for Kittens With Long Hair?

Yes, you can use slicker brushes on long-haired kittens, but only if they’re specifically designed for delicate fur and sensitive skin. Choose a brush with fine, short pins under 0.5 inches long and soft, coated tips to prevent irritation. Apply light pressure and brush in small sections, no more than 5 minutes daily. Avoid metal bristle brushes meant for adults-opt for silicone-tipped or rounded pins to protect your kitten’s developing coat and skin during grooming sessions.

Is It Normal for My Cat to Resist Brushing?

Yes, it’s normal for your cat to resist brushing. Many cats find the sensation unfamiliar or irritating. Start with short sessions using a soft, high-density bristle brush with gently tapered polymer pins. Apply minimal pressure-about 200–300 grams of force-to avoid discomfort. Gradually increase duration. Use positive reinforcement. Over time, consistent brushing improves coat health and reduces resistance.
